Abstract:
Abnormalities of liver function in giant cell arteritis (GCA) have long been described1 and are present at the acute phase of the disease in 30% to 60% of cases.2-4 Hepatic involvement is mostly anicteric cholestasis (eg, elevated alkaline phosphatase [ALP] and gamma-glutamyl transferase [GGT]), and, more rarely, cytolytic hepatitis (eg, elevated aspartate aminotransferase [AST] and/or alanine aminotransferase [ALT]).
